    Phoenix Wright: Ace Attorney, developed and published by Capcom, is a visual novel adventure game that blends puzzle-solving and legal drama. The player takes on the role of Phoenix Wright, a rookie defense attorney, and must defend their clients against false accusations. The gameplay is split into two main sections: investigation and courtroom battles. During the investigation phase, you gather evidence, interview witnesses, and examine crime scenes. This phase is super important because the clues you find here are essential to winning the case later. When you're in court, you present your evidence, cross-examine witnesses, and expose inconsistencies in their testimonies. It's a game of wits, where you have to find the truth and protect the innocent. The series is known for its memorable characters, clever writing, and unique gameplay mechanics. Each game features multiple cases, with their own mysteries and challenges. You'll meet a cast of unforgettable characters, including Wright's mentor Mia Fey, the eccentric detective Dick Gumshoe, and the ever-optimistic Maya Fey. The stories are full of twists, turns, and surprising revelations. You'll need to pay close attention to every detail, analyze witness statements carefully, and use your evidence to expose the truth.     Understanding the Gameplay Mechanics

    Alright, let's break down the core mechanics of how to play Phoenix Wright: Ace Attorney. This is where we learn the ropes! The game is split into two primary segments: investigation and courtroom trials. During the investigation phase, you'll be gathering clues. This involves exploring locations, talking to people, and collecting evidence. Pay close attention to every detail! Click on objects in the environment to examine them. Talk to all the characters you encounter, and choose all the dialogue options to make sure you get all the information. The evidence you collect here will be crucial when you get into the courtroom. The courtroom phase is where you'll present your findings. This is where you cross-examine witnesses. You'll listen to their testimony and try to find contradictions or inconsistencies. If you find a contradiction, present evidence to expose the lie. The goal is to prove your client's innocence and reveal the real culprit. Use the "Present" command to present evidence, and the "Press" command to press witnesses for further information. The courtroom battles are the heart of the game, and they're all about logical thinking, deduction, and paying attention to detail. During cross-examination, witnesses will give their testimonies. You'll have to read and listen carefully, because often, the truth is hidden in the details. Then, use the evidence you've collected to show that the witness is lying or mistaken. You'll have to find contradictions in their statements. Once you find one, present evidence to expose the lie. Be careful though, presenting the wrong evidence or making too many mistakes can lead to penalties! Understanding these core mechanics is the key to succeeding in the game.

    Essential Characters and Their Roles

    Phoenix Wright: Ace Attorney boasts a cast of unforgettable characters, each playing a vital role in the stories. Let's meet some of the most important ones.

    • Phoenix Wright: The protagonist and your character! He's the rookie defense attorney that you play as, known for his determination, wit, and tendency to shout "Objection!" He's got a strong sense of justice and is always ready to defend his clients, even when the odds are stacked against him.
    • Maya Fey: Phoenix's close friend and assistant. She's a spirit medium in training and often provides helpful insights and support during investigations and trials. Her cheerful personality and supernatural abilities add a unique flavor to the game, and she's a loyal friend, always there to lend a helping hand. She has a deep connection to the Fey clan, and her spiritual abilities often come in handy.
    • Mia Fey: Phoenix's mentor and Maya's older sister. Mia is a brilliant attorney who guides Phoenix through the early cases. She is smart, calm under pressure, and has a knack for seeing through lies. She's a mentor, a friend, and a crucial figure in shaping Phoenix's skills. She's always there, even when she isn't physically present.
    • Detective Dick Gumshoe: A detective who often works with Phoenix. He's a bit clumsy and often lacks attention to detail, but he's a good guy at heart, always trying his best. He provides essential information, even if he doesn't always come across as the brightest bulb in the box. His dedication to justice, even if he's a bit of a goofball, is always there.

    Tips and Tricks to Become a Pro Attorney

    Let's get you ready for some serious courtroom action with these killer tips and tricks!

    • Examine Everything: Don't skip anything! Click on every object, talk to everyone, and explore every corner. The smallest details can often be crucial.
    • Pay Attention: Always read everything carefully. The witness testimonies, evidence descriptions, and dialogue all contain vital clues.
    • Take Notes: Keep track of key details, characters, and inconsistencies. This will help you keep track of your progress.
    • Don't Be Afraid to Press: Press witnesses for more information. This can often reveal contradictions or new clues.
    • Use Your Evidence Wisely: Choose the right evidence to present at the right time. Timing is key in the courtroom!
    • Trust Your Gut: If something feels wrong, it probably is. Don't be afraid to challenge witnesses and present evidence.
    • Save Often: Save your game frequently so you can go back and try different approaches if you get stuck.
    • Review Everything: Don't rush through the game. Take your time, re-read evidence, and review witness statements if you get stuck. You might find something you missed the first time around.
    • Be Patient: Phoenix Wright: Ace Attorney is a game of puzzle-solving and deduction. Take your time and enjoy the experience.
    • Experiment: Try different things. You can always reload your save and try again. Sometimes the most unexpected solutions work.
